Leadership Review Briefing — Legacy Pricing, Corvale Analytics. For sales leads: we propose a 9% uplift for customers on legacy Meridian contracts, effective at renewal. Roughly 240 accounts are affected, most on plans untouched since the Harwick acquisition. Modelling suggests churn of under 3% if paired with a feature-parity upgrade offer. Talking points and objection-handling scripts are in the shared folder. Please hold all customer communication until the confidential note below is reviewed.

confidential, kagup-bafog: Fraaxax Group is in early talks to buy Soroxox Group for about $343.8 million. The Olidor launch date is June 14, and nothing goes to the press before then. Legal wants the Aldmirek Logistics term sheet signed before July 23.

Subject: DR drill next Thursday — Graphlet viz

Hi! Quick heads-up: we're running the disaster-recovery drill for Graphlet, our dependency graph visualizer, on Thursday morning. Your part is simple — restore the render cache from the Fenwick Bay snapshot and confirm the graph loads. Nothing scary, I'll be on the call. To unseal the snapshot archive, use the recovery phrase below.

recovery phrase for yajeg-tagep: rusok-briwyn-belvan-kelax-novmir-fenath-eliael-fraok-holok

Subject: Cut-over complete — Stockmend reconciliation job

Team,

The nightly inventory reconciliation moved from the legacy Bartel scheduler to the new Orlun pipeline at 02:00 without incident. Row counts matched across all three warehouses, and runtime dropped from 94 to 31 minutes. The legacy job is disabled but retained for two weeks. The active production configuration after cut-over is below.

deployment values, kajep-kageg:
[praix]
host = praix.paliqcorp.corp
user = praix_svc
database = praix_prod

## Key Ceremony Checklist — Item 7: Farecrest Rules Engine

Before signing the quarterly key rotation for Farecrest, the shipping-fee rules engine, confirm that all three custodians from the Ordwell team have verified the rule-pack checksums against the printed ledger. Record the ceremony timestamp and witness initials in the logbook. On-call: if a custodian is unavailable, the standby quorum procedure applies. Once quorum is confirmed, unseal the signing enclave using the recovery passphrase that appears below.

vault phrase of yawig-bawig = fenael-norael-eliox-gilox-casath-druath-zorys-istwyn-jorwyn